On this episode of Between Two Beers we talk to Lauren Rae.
I don't say this lightly, but this is one of the most powerful eps we've done.
Lauren is one of our Low Key Legends, who's currently in the fight of her life against melanoma.
After going to the Commonwealth Games as a weightlifter, Lauren was given a terminal cancer diagnosis for a rare non-sun related melanoma which contained a gene called BRAF v600e.
Despite having the melanoma surgically removed Lauren was told the cancer cells had spread to her lymph nodes, and that should she decide to join the clinical trial at Auckland Hospital, the doctors didn't think it would be of any use.
Staring mortality in the face, Lauren questioned her diagnosis. She chose to fight, seeking second and third opinions that eventually opened the door to hope and led her family to going all in on Australia.
Within a week of speaking to her Brisbane Oncologist, Lauren's family sold their car, took leave without pay and told their three and five year old, they were off on holiday.
